Where can I find a reliable Mazda repair shop near Pilger, Nebraska?

While Pilger itself is a small town, residents typically rely on reputable service centers in nearby larger communities like Norfolk, Columbus, or Sioux City. Look for shops that are ASE-certified and have specific experience with Mazda vehicles, as they will have the proper diagnostic tools and training for models like the CX-5 or Mazda3.

What are common Mazda repair issues for vehicles driven in Nebraska's climate?

The extreme temperature swings and winter road treatments in the Pilger area can accelerate corrosion, making undercarriage and brake line inspections crucial. Additionally, Mazda models with the SkyActiv engine may require close attention to the battery and charging system, as cold starts place extra strain on these components during Nebraska winters.

How do I know when my Mazda needs professional service beyond basic oil changes?

Pay attention to dashboard warning lights, especially the check engine light, which should be diagnosed promptly with professional scan tools. Unusual noises from the suspension or steering, common on rural Stanton County roads, or a decrease in fuel efficiency are also clear signs to seek a professional inspection at a local shop.

Are Mazda repair parts readily available for Pilger residents, or will there be long waits?

Most common maintenance parts for Mazdas are readily available through regional distributors, so local shops can typically source them quickly. For major or specific parts, there may be a short delay for delivery from larger hubs, but a qualified shop in Norfolk or Columbus will provide an accurate timeline for your repair.
